Following adjustment for gestational age and sex, the association between major anomalies and BW/PW ratio was https://datingranking.net/nl/tsdates-overzicht/ analyzed. No difference in BW/PW ratio was seen between groups with or without major anomalies (Table 1) and the three categories of BW/PW ratios were equally distributed between the groups (Table 3). The prevalence of major anomalies was (12%) in the <10th percentile of BW/PW ratio, (15%) in the 10–90th percentile, and 6/24 (25%) in the >90th percentile. The number needed to diagnose a major anomaly varied between the three groups, with 8.3 in the <10th percentile of BW/PW ratio, 6.7 in the 10–90th percentile and 4.0 in the >90th percentile. The highest proportion of infants with major anomalies was observed in the >90th percentile of BW/PW ratio.
